- The New Jerusalem is a setting taken from the last book of the Bible: Revelations 21: i-iv. It is a prophetic message of renewal.
I originally wrote a choral work called The Heavenly Jerusalem in 1969, for soprano, alto, baritone choir, speaker and organ. This version uses the material of the old and specifies soloists instead of the choral forces. The new version is much simplified and is thought to be more appropriate to concert performance rather than a liturgical setting.
